Castro, Paraná vs Brinkley, Ar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Castro, Paraná, Brazil and Brinkley, Ar, Usa is approximately 7,928 km or 4,927 mi.
  • To reach Castro, Paraná in this distance one would set out from Brinkley, Ar bearing 140.9°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Castro, Paraná bearing 145.2° or SE .
  • Castro, Paraná has a subtropical highland climate with no dry season (Cfb) whereas Brinkley, Ar has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Castro, Paraná is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Brinkley, Ar is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 0.5 °C (0.9°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 16.5 °C (29.7°F) less in Castro, Paraná.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 295.2 mm (11.6 in) more which is equivalent to 295.2 l/m² (7.24 US gal/ft²) or 2,952,000 l/ha (315,588 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.3° higher in Castro, Paraná than in Brinkley, Ar.
